KSA to utilise culture towards a green future cementing its position for the Kingdom’s Vision 2030 focus on climate change

Under the patronage of His Highness Prince Badr bin Abdullah bin Farhan Al Saud, Saudi Arabia’s Minister of Culture and Chairman of the Saudi National Commission for Education, Culture and Science, and in cooperation with the Arab League Educational, Cultural and Scientific Organisation (ALECSO), hosted the 23rd session of the Conference of Arab Culture Ministers on, Wednesday (December 7, 2022) in the city of Riyadh. Ministers and officials from 20 Arab countries, as well as representatives of the League of Arab States and international and regional organisations were present at the event. His Highness the Minister of Culture said: “This year’s session, centred around the main theme, ‘Culture for a Green Future,’ aims to make the cultural sector more sustainable. We seek to be a launchpad for global efforts that include culture in all its forms and extend it to cover all elements of its value chain. His Highness added: “Employing culture towards a green future contributes to its consolidation in the global development debate, which is something that the Saudi leadership give their full attention to. The main theme of the conference, ‘Culture for a Green Future’, is also in line with the objectives of Saudi Vision 2030. Hence, the Kingdom supports collective efforts to enhance knowledge, skills, and practices related to making the cultural sector more sustainable and environmentally friendly.” During the conference, the Arab Culture Ministers stressed the importance of giving new impetus to the role of culture in achieving sustainable development, while working to develop effective policies for sectors that provide added value in the collective efforts to shift towards a more creative and sustainable future.
